[Adopted 6-6-2011 ATM by Art. 26]
These bylaws may be altered, repealed or amended by the two-thirds vote at any Annual Town Meeting or at any other Town Meeting specially called for the purpose, an article, or articles for such purpose having been inserted in the Warrant for such meeting.
All proposed bylaws or changes in existing bylaws must be submitted to the Bylaw Review Committee and to Town Counsel at least 60 days prior to the date of the Town Meeting, except as is provided by law.
These bylaws shall take effect upon their publication or posting, acceptance and approval as required by law, and all the bylaws previously adopted by the Town of Plainville are hereby repealed upon the date of such publication or posting, acceptance and approval.
If any provision herein, or the application of such provision to any person or circumstance, shall be held invalid, the validity of the remainder of this set of bylaws, and applicability of such provision to other persons or circumstance, shall not be affected thereby.

[Adopted 6-6-2011 ATM by Art. 26]
The Town accepted the renumbering and revision of the various general bylaws of the Town to the numbering or codification, arrangement, sequence and captions and the comprehensive revisions to the text of the General Bylaws as set forth in the Draft of the Code of the Town of Plainville, dated April 2011, said codification having been done under the direction of the Board of Selectmen and Town Attorney, and said Code being a compilation and comprehensive revision of the present bylaws of the Town. All bylaws of a general and permanent nature, as amended, heretofore in force and not included in the Code shall be repealed, except that such repeal shall not affect any suit or proceeding pending as the result of an existing law, and such repeal shall not apply to or affect any personnel bylaw or any bylaw, order or article heretofore adopted accepting or adopting the provisions of any statute of the commonwealth. These bylaws shall be referred to as the "Code of the Town of Plainville, Massachusetts."
[Adopted 6-6-2011 ATM by Art. 27]
The Town voted to accept the renumbering and revision of the Personnel Bylaw of the Town from its original numbering to the numbering or codification, arrangement, sequence and captions and the comprehensive revisions to the text of the Personnel Bylaw as set forth in the Draft of the Code of the Town of Plainville, dated April 2011, said codification having been done under the direction of the Board of Selectmen and Town Attorney, and being a compilation and comprehensive revision of the present Personnel Bylaw of the Town, including amendments thereto. All Personnel Bylaws, as amended, heretofore in force and not included in Chapter 515 shall be repealed, except that such repeal shall not affect any suit or proceeding pending as the result of an existing law, and such repeal shall not apply to or affect any personnel bylaw or any bylaw, order or article heretofore adopted accepting or adopting the provisions of any statute of the commonwealth. The Personnel Bylaw shall be codified as Chapter 515 of the "Code of the Town of Plainville, Massachusetts."
[Adopted 6-6-2011 ATM by Art. 28]
The Town voted to accept the renumbering and revision of the Zoning Bylaw of the Town from its original numbering to the numbering or codification, arrangement, sequence and captions and the comprehensive revisions to the text of the Zoning Bylaw as set forth in the Draft of the Code of the Town of Plainville, dated April 2011, said codification of the Zoning Bylaw having been done under the direction of the Planning Board, and being a compilation and comprehensive revision of the present Zoning Bylaw, including amendments thereto. All Zoning Bylaws, as amended, heretofore in force and not included in Chapter 500 shall be repealed, except that such repeal shall not affect any suit or proceeding pending as the result of an existing law. The Zoning Bylaw shall be codified as Chapter 500 of the "Code of the Town of Plainville, Massachusetts."
